The Windermere Prep Lakers will square off against the Out-of-Door Academy Thunder at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The teams are rolling into the game with opposing streaks: Windermere Prep has struggled recently with three losses in a row, while Out-of-Door Academy will arrive with nine straight victories.
Last Friday, Windermere Prep came up short against Duval Charter and fell 14-7.
Meanwhile, Out-of-Door Academy won against Sarasota Christian back in September with 36 points and they decided to stick to that point total again on Friday. Out-of-Door Academy was the clear victor by a 36-14 margin over Seffner Christian. The Thunder might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four matches by 20 points or more this season.
Windermere Prep's defeat dropped their record down to 1-5-1. As for Out-of-Door Academy, their win was their fifth straight on the road d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 6-0.
Everything went Windermere Prep's way against Out-of-Door Academy in their previous matchup back in October of 2016, as Windermere Prep made off with a 35-14 victory. The rematch might be a little tougher for Windermere Prep since the squad won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
